    Caring for Your Lizaro Pieces: Extending Life and Reducing Waste

    Looking after lizaro clothing and homeware is a simple but powerful way to honour the sustainable thinking built into each item and to reduce waste in New Zealand communities. Washing garments and textiles in cold water saves energy and helps preserve both colour and fabric strength, whether you live in a city flat or a rural home on tank water. Gentle, low-scent detergents are kinder to fibres and to local waterways, a point that matters in regions with fragile streams and coastal zones. Air-drying on a line or rack rather than using a dryer cuts power use and guards against shrinkage, while drying in the shade or indoors reduces sun fade, a common issue in bright New Zealand conditions. Small repairs have a big effect: re-stitching a loose seam, mending a small tear, or replacing a missing button can keep a favourite shirt, duvet cover or cushion in use for years longer. For households in humid or coastal areas, storing off-season pieces in breathable cotton bags with good airflow helps prevent mould and mildew, while keeping wardrobes and linen cupboards clean and dry slows wear. Rotate bedding and cushion covers to spread out use, and follow the care tags on each lizaro item, which are written to balance ease with longevity. By building these care habits into weekly routines, you support the original purpose of sustainable fashion and homeware: fewer items bought in haste, more items cherished, repair over discard, and a steady drop in what ends up in rubbish bags and local landfills.
